Transaction

f83ea7a0d124c3e4cc4e9a492fa4c1a6f28828ef95e8a74be934d7651889434d
283,003 confirmations
Timestamp
1603552035
Block654,122
Fee25,610 sats
Fee rate130 sats/vB
view on mempool.space

Inputs & Outputs